chess_and_checkers_same_boardIn our opinion, the only thing one can predict about the stock market with certainty is that it will fluctuate – period! All other predictions are speculative and illusionary. We therefore advise our clients to pursue investments only if they posses these four qualities: Liquidity, Safety, Decent Return, Tax Advantage.

1.    Liquidity. You are able to readily access your money whenever you want to, without paying hefty penalties.

2.    Safety. Is your investment guaranteed or insured? Does the investment lose value when the stock market plunges?

3.    Decent Returns. Isn’t that why you invested in the first place?

4.    Tax Advantage. Although the majority of financial professionals completely ignore this critical piece, lateral wealth does not matter much at the end of the day. What is really important is how much you get to spend after paying taxes. Your return and your ultimate spendable funds will be enhanced if the investment enjoys a tax advantage.

Typical Investing Dilemmas

Numerous investments promise a high return, but most of them also expose investors to high risks – making them very unsafe. Several are not liquid enough, making it almost impossible for investors to access their funds in a timely manner without typically being hit with huge penalties. Most of the safe investments offer too poor a rate of return to outpace the cost of living.

The vast majority of investors are heavily invested in qualified plans like 401(k)s and IRAs. These plans usually fail our test because one cannot readily access the funds without having to borrow and repay the money on a set schedule, or pay income taxes and penalties if younger than age 59˝ (with some exceptions). Given that almost all of the funds in such accounts are invested directly in the stock market, safety is completely compromised – 2008 being a significant case in point.
